Transaction e4fafdd9735982549e876ad5375aea41ed89f22f33356bb6fea56432f0a54677
1 Input
1 Output
-
e4fafdd9735982549e876ad5375aea41ed89f22f33356bb6fea56432f0a54677:0
- value
- 170000
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 218de9161f420e72b975d5ee4bf1705076b3e5b9 OP_EQUAL
- address
- 34kSDzGK3QieSk2u9p5BybT6n7J8kJtVdY